Re: SM-841 and unqualified

On 8/2/07, Alexander Logvinov <al...@softech.ru> wrote:
>
>  Hello,
>  I've got a question regarding SM-841 issue (The servicemix-http provider
> endpoint does not properly handle web services that return faults with
> multiple elements in the detail section.)
>
>  The current version works fine, wrapping multiple faults into
> <multiple-details> tag but this tag is not qualified.
>  This makes the work with such faults slightly harder, for example I am
> having troubles while declaring the wrapper message type with unqualified
> <multiple-details> body to make these faults available in ODE.
>
>  Can Servicemix declare <multiple-details> tag in some namespace? I think it
> would be more convenient for processing faults.

Please file a new JIRA issue and link it to SM-841.
